Teachers incorporate different learning strategies to help students to have a better learning experience.Game based learning has won much appreciation owing to the flexibility in approach and the many benefits that lead to positive learning outcomes.In a learning through gaming environment, students can have a more active and experiential learning as most of the times they learn by doing.As they get exposed to challenges in a competitive set up, students would grow up with improved spirits of learning.Also group gaming activities help them to better the exposure to teamwork and collaboration.Moreover, classroom games are a solution to engage students and gain their attention while relieving them from the boredom of regular classroom sessions.However, choosing the right set of games for the appropriate class levels is important and the role of teacher matters.

Improved memory capacity

Most of the games utilize the student’s memory capacity. So including more games that tests or challenges their memory can help to get better their memory power.Educational memory games such as bingo are widely used in classrooms that are a good means to teach mathematical expressions.Games such as Jeopardy are also a memory booster which can be used as a tool to revise daily lessons at the end of a class or just before exams.

Motivates and engages students

This is a platform for entertainment amidst many tiring text book exercises and assignments.The interactive experience in a gaming environment gives them a sense of achievement.In addition to getting unlimited fun, they get a chance to go by the rules, evaluate measurable goals, understand definitive objectives, and involve in healthy competition.They get easily motivated through hands-on gaming activities and this method of learn and play is a better way to engage students in classrooms.

Enhanced computer & simulation fluency

In this digital world, students get familiarized with the use of computer technology and internet when playing online games.They will learn to use the mouse, keyboard and computer techniques while getting the fun and excitement of play time.This gives them a chance to learn the technology without actually having the feel of studying.They can easily learn how to navigate between pages, browsing and adding authentication details such as ID and password while enjoying games.

Better hand-eye coordination

The games that are played using mouse, keyboard or gamepads are a great way to improve the hand eye coordination of students.They get used to managing how their hand works while responding to the actions on the screen which is equally important like other aptitude skills.The cartoon network games are the best option for students to enhance their overall coordination.In addition to these physical skills, the multi player games are a good platform for students to improve their motivation, perseverance, self control, and patience.

Opportunities for skill-building

The adventure and mystery games are a great way for students to improve their different skill set.Most of such games ask them to read different types of maps and stimulates practical thinking.Group gaming activities and related stuff teaches them to cooperate among a team and improves their general project management.Moreover, digital and non digital adventure games are a good option to teach new languages.The skill acquisition games help students to better their social, cognitive and physical skills.The mindset to explore new things helps them in their real life as well to try new things without any set back.

Stimulate a creative mindset

When they fail in a game once, they will come up with a better idea to pass it the next time and more.This is a means to stimulate a creative mindset among students as they come up with more interesting options every time.While finding out solutions to different game puzzles, they turn out to be more creative and imaginative.Creative games such as blind artist are used widely while teachers find it difficult to introduce new subjects
